Amp'd Mobile - Amp'd Mobile is a cellular service launched in late 2005 to market to the younger generation, typically 18-35 year olds. Using 3G technology will highly emphasize mobile entertainment while including the communication functions of a typical cell phone.

Mobile computing - Mobile Computing is a generic term describing the application of small, portable, and wireless computing and communication devices. This includes devices like laptops with wireless LAN technology, mobile phones, wearable computers and Personal Digital Assistants (PDAs) with Bluetooth or IRDA interfaces, and USB flash drives.

Advanced Mobile Telephone System - The Advanced Mobile Telephone System (not to be confused with Advanced Mobile Phone System) was a 0G method of radio communication, mainly used in Japanese portable radio systems. It, like its successor HCMTS, operated on the 900 MHz band.
